Are tougher days coming for approval of agribusiness certification trademarks in Australia?

Photo of Georgina Hey (AU)Photo of Amanda Caldwell (AU)
By Georgina Hey (AU) & Amanda Caldwell (AU) on November 29, 2018

On 22 November 2018 the Australian Competition and Consumer Commission (ACCC) issued its initial assessment of the rules governing use of four certification trade marks in the name of OxoPak Pty Ltd, indicating its intention deny approval for the certification rules, and therefore the trade marks will be denied.
